Under U.S. GAAP, all internally generated research and growth prices are required to be expensed as incurred. Under IAS 38, Intangible Assets, all prices recognized as analysis costs are to be expensed; nonetheless, prices identified as improvement prices are to be capitalized in the occasion that they meet specified criteria.Capital Stock Ownership shares of a corporation approved by its articles of incorporation. The stability sheet account with the aggregate amount of the par worth or stated worth of all stock issued by an organization. Additional Paid in Capital Amounts paid for stock in extra of its par value or stated value. Also, other amounts paid by stockholders and charged to equity accounts aside from capital stock. Order Of LiquidityThe presentation of assorted property in the steadiness sheet with the time it takes for every to be converted into cash is called the order of liquidity. Cash is taken into account a most liquid asset, followed by cash equivalents, marketable securities, account receivables, inventories, non-current investments, loans and advances, fastened belongings.Assets are sources that you simply personal and can be bought, and are listed in order of liquidity. For example, money or inventory are listed above less liquid belongings like property or tools. Note that not like income and expense accounts, asset, liability, and fairness accounts are known as “permanent accounts” because they carry over from yr to yr, and their values regulate accordingly. The income and expense accounts are known as “temporary accounts” since their worth is calculated at the finish of each year because the accounts are closed. Generally, a transaction posts to the overall journal earlier than it makes its approach to the final ledger. The general ledger is the second point of entry for recording transactions after it enters the accounting system through the general journal. The common ledger is a abstract of every enterprise transaction on the account degree.Match the transactions reported in the account within the period to the underlying transactions, and regulate as necessary. In Accordance With A CpaThe mutual fund's distributions to you of dividends it receives generally qualify for a similar tax relief as long-term capital gains. If the mutual fund passes via its short-term capital positive aspects, these will be reported to you as "odd dividends" that don't qualify for relief. A money circulate projection estimates the amount of cash that you simply anticipate to come into and move out of your corporation. Also often known as a cash move forecast, a cash move projection could be created for any period, with some small businesses even making a weekly cash move projection.Simply addContent your current cash circulate forecast as your Fathom finances, then use our link to budget function to get began.
